Summary Of Position
The Director of FP&A owns the company's planning cadence, management reporting, and financial narrative for executives, investors, and the board. This person should operate as a true thought partner to the CFO by translating operating performance into insight, recommending actions, and producing reporting packages that require minimal CFO rewriting.
Essential Functions- Lead the annual, semi-annual, quarterly, and rolling forecast processes.
- Own monthly investor/president reporting, internal business reviews, and quarterly board materials, including commentary and storyline.
- Build and maintain three‑statement financial models and 13‑week cash flow forecasts to support planning and decision‑making.
- Partner with accounting, project finance, and operations to explain variances, consolidate site forecasts, and identify risks and opportunities.
- Support strategic projects, including mergers and acquisitions analysis, scenario modeling, and executive decision support.
- Use and improve tools such as SAP and Hyperion for reporting, planning, and Hyperion retrieve based reporting workflows.
-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or a related field required; MBA, CPA, CFA, or FPAC preferred.
- 8-12+ years of progressive FP&A, corporate finance, investment banking, or related experience, with prior leadership responsibility.
- Advanced financial modeling, forecasting, and variance analysis skills, including strong knowledge of P&L, balance sheet, and cash flow relationships.
- Excellent communication and presentation skills, with the ability to create executive ready decks and written commentary.
- Experience with ERP tools and strong Excel and PowerPoint capability; SAP and Hyperion familiarity are strong advantages.
